Derin O Danos, the alchemy vendor in Plane of Knowledge, has most of the supplies needed for making the new OOW augments.
He has an "Open Letter" parts one and two that explains the three step process to create the finished augment.
He also has everything needed to make them except for the dropped items.
Some of the dropped items are appearing on other threads in this forum. The Flowstones are the base piece needed (and gemstones from harder as yet undiscovered encounters). Then using the vendor bought items off Derin (or other alchemy or poison vendors that have them) a jeweller can "cut" the stone in any of three different ways. Then using the vendor bought items, a shammy alchemist or rogue poison maker can "etch" any of several marks that are for sale into the stone. Finally using a combination of vendor bought and dropped items (the drops are the Trean Flies and The Scoriae) can "inlay" the stone for the final combine.
The stones and all the items are droppable up until the final combination has been made and the finished augment is put onto a piece of equipment, at which point the augment becomes no drop, though it can still be removed from your equipment with the appropriate solvent.
